This rule applies only ... Web8 apr. 2024 · Yes, you may take the MCAT multiple times. You may take the test three times in a testing year, four times in two consecutive years, or seven times in a lifetime. Note that if...
Web8 nov. 2024 · Although the mean total MCAT score among all applicants is 506.5, successful MD applicants typically achieve an MCAT total score at or above the 71st percentile (i.e., 508+). Moreover, the average (i.e., mean) total MCAT score among successful applicants lands around the 83rd percentile (511.9) and continues to trend …
